Why Crabgrass Preventer Pre Emergent Is Necessary

I’ve found that using a crabgrass preventer pre emergent is one of the smartest steps I can take if I want a healthier lawn. Crabgrass is stubborn, fast-growing, and once it shows up, it spreads quickly and becomes much harder to control. By applying a pre emergent early, I stop the weed before it even has a chance to germinate, which saves me a lot of time and frustration later.

My lawn also looks much better when I stay ahead of the problem instead of trying to fix it after the weeds appear. Crabgrass competes with my grass for water, sunlight, and nutrients, so preventing it helps my turf grow thicker and stronger. I’ve noticed that a well-timed pre emergent gives my lawn a better chance to stay green, even, and healthy through the season.

Another reason I rely on crabgrass preventer is that it is much easier and more effective than trying to remove crabgrass after it has already taken over. In my experience, prevention always works better than treatment. Using a pre emergent lets me protect my lawn early, reduce weed pressure, and keep my yard looking clean with less effort overall.

My Buying Guides on Crabgrass Preventer Pre Emergent

What I Look for First

When I shop for a crabgrass preventer pre emergent, the first thing I check is whether it’s meant to stop crabgrass before it sprouts. I always want a product that clearly says “pre-emergent” and specifically mentions crabgrass control. If that part is unclear, I move on.

Application Timing

I’ve learned that timing matters more than almost anything else. I try to apply pre-emergent early in the season, before crabgrass seeds germinate. In my experience, it works best when I use it before soil temperatures rise enough for crabgrass to start growing.

Active Ingredient

I always read the active ingredient on the label. Common ingredients like prodiamine, dithiopyr, and pendimethalin are the ones I usually compare. I pick based on how long I want protection to last and whether I need a product that also offers some post-emergent control for very young crabgrass.

Granular vs. Liquid

I decide between granular and liquid based on convenience and my lawn size. Granular products are easier for me to spread with a broadcast spreader, while liquid products give me more control in some situations. I choose the one I know I can apply evenly.

Lawn Type Compatibility

I always make sure the product is safe for my grass type. Some pre-emergents are fine for cool-season lawns, while others are better for warm-season grasses. I never assume a product is universal, because I’ve seen labels vary a lot.

Coverage Area

I check how much lawn the bag or bottle covers before I buy it. I like comparing cost per square foot instead of just looking at the price tag. That helps me figure out which option gives me better value for my yard.

Rainfast and Watering Instructions

I pay close attention to watering directions after application. Some products need to be watered in right away, and others need a short drying period first. I always follow the label because I know the product won’t work properly if I skip this step.

Weed Prevention Window

I look at how long the product claims to prevent crabgrass and other weeds. Some formulas last longer than others, and I prefer a product that gives me season-long protection if I’m trying to avoid repeat applications.

Safety Around New Seed

If I’m planning to seed my lawn, I check whether the pre-emergent will interfere with grass seed germination. This is important to me because some products can prevent desirable grass seed from growing too. I only buy a product that fits my lawn plan.

Ease of Use

I prefer products that are simple to apply and easy to understand. Clear instructions, measured coverage, and straightforward spreading make my job easier. If the label is confusing, I usually choose a different option.

My Final Buying Tip

My best advice is to buy based on my lawn type, my timing, and the active ingredient—not just the brand name. When I match the product to my yard’s needs, I get better crabgrass prevention and fewer surprises later in the season.
